Bus Switches
Overview
Frontgrade bus switch family is perfect for high speed, bus isolation applications.
Our bus switch devices provides interface solutions to address bus loading and isolation and redundancy and removes the need for actual cold sparing multiplexer inputs to reduce your solution cost!
Frontgrade's bus switches are designed to provide high-performance and reliability in harsh environments. They offer features such as low power consumption, high bandwidth, and radiation hardening. This makes them ideal for use in a variety of applications, including military, aerospace, and industrial.
